The Media Turns its Attention to the Campaign 2012 Academic Seminar

September 21, 2012 The Washington Center

TWC Seminar participants get a private tour of the RNC convention floor

Over the course of a month, over 70 different media outlets covered, wrote stories and turned the attention of their online readers to TWC's Campaign 2012 Academic Seminar.

This seminar provided students with a once-in-a-lifetime opportunity to hear from prominent speakers, participate in fieldwork placements at the Tampa Bay Times Forum and the Time Warner Cable Arena and network with political figures from the first African American mayor of North Carolina to the Executive Producer of the Democratic National Convention. The Washington Center is the largest and most established student internship program in Washington, D.C. Since our founding, we've helped more than 60,000 individuals from across the U.S. and around the globe expand their academic pursuits into rewarding jobs and careers.
